Around the World's Markets: Hong Kong

LEADING SHARES ended higher in a session shortened by bad weather. The blue-chip Hang Seng index closed up 60.21 points, or 0.44 per cent, at 13,633.87.

The market was helped by another record overnight close on Wall Street, but the local market was again hit by profit-taking near the close.

While a record Dow Jones close on Monday at 11,299.76 initially helped the market, it quickly ran out of steam.
